Best answer: How do I make a clickable element in HTML?

We simply add the onlcick event and add a location to it. Then, additionally and optionally, we add a cursor: pointer to indicate to the user the div is clickable. This will make the whole div clickable.

What HTML elements are clickable?

The <button> tag defines a clickable button. Inside a <button> element you can put text (and tags like <i> , <b> , <strong> , <br> , <img> , etc.). That is not possible with a button created with the <input> element!

Just have an anchor (a) tag within the DIV that links to the URL you want. Then, set it to a block display, relative positioning, left and top equal to 0, width and height to full (or use jQuery to match all A’s within DIV’s to the same dimensions as the DIV). Great Solution! This really helped.

How do I make a table cell clickable in HTML?

Add the onClick event on the td mark. There is a very simple way of doing this with just HTML. Put the link text inside a DIV. The DIV occupies the whole TD and makes it all clickable.

How do you make a clickable span?

What are the 10 basic HTML tags?

Your First 10 HTML Tags

  • <html> … </html> — The root element. …
  • <head> … </head> — The document head. …
  • <title> … </title> — The page title. …
  • <body> … </body> — The page’s content. …
  • <h1> … </h1> — A section heading. …
  • <p> … </p> — A paragraph. …
  • <a> … </a> — A link. …
  • <img> — An image. The img element lets you insert images into your web pages.

What is a tag in HTML?

The HTML <a> tag is an inline HTML element that defines a hyperlink. Hyperlinks allow users to navigate from one page to another. The following sections contain information about this tag, including examples of how it is used and related attributes and browser compatibility. Examples of <a> tag.

How do I make a div not clickable?

One possible workaround is to bind a click event to the overlaying element, and then get the current mouse position & compare that to the position of the element underneath in order to determine whether or not that element should register a click.

How do you make a clickable card?

Making the whole card clickable

  1. Positioning each list item relative makes sure all positioned elements are contained in it.
  2. Create an overlay over the whole list item that links to the document works with CSS generated content. Setting a z-index of 1 makes sure this covers all elements without positioning.
Can a div have a href?

you can’t use the href attribute on a div element. to make a whole div a link you need to wrap div element within an anchor element i.e.

Hyperlink is a pointer from one HTML document to another one, the target may be same website location or some other location on the Internet. You can add links inside the Table Cells.

How do I make a table in HTML?

To create table in HTML, use the <table> tag. A table consist of rows and columns, which can be set using one or more <tr>, <th>, and <td> elements. A table row is defined by the <tr> tag. To set table header, use the <th> tag.

How do you expand and collapse HTML table rows on click?

First Option for expanding/collapsing HTML table row

  1. Put a class of “parent” on each parent row (tr).
  2. Give each parent row (tr) an attribute ”data-toggle=”toggle””.
  3. Give each child row cover under <tbody> a class=hideTr.

How do I make an entire list clickable?

2 Answers. Add display:block to the anchor element and move the padding from the list item to the anchor element. This will ensure that the entire area is covered by the anchor element and is therefore clickable.

How do I make an iframe clickable?

To do this, use the overflow:hidden css attribute on the a tag, which slices off any content not fitting within the border-box. You could create a overlay to make the area over a iframe clickable.

<a> stands for anchor

<a> elements without an [href] attribute were historically assigned a [name] attribute, which could be used as the destination of the fragment identifier. Browsers later added support for linking to any item’s [id] attribute, and this is now the preferred method for linking to a document fragment.

